EU Targets A7 Crypto Network Over Alleged Role in Russian Election Meddling

The European Union has unleashed a new wave of sanctions against the shadowy A7 Crypto Network, a move that appears to be a direct response to its alleged interference in the Russian elections. Announced today, July 16, 2025, this action marks another chapter in the ongoing geopolitical chess game involving digital currencies and their role in international politics.

Sanctions and Their Ripple Effects

In a bold maneuver, the EU aims to torpedo A7’s operations by targeting its access to European markets. The network, an enigmatic player in the crypto arena, has been accused of meddling in Russia’s political processโ€”an allegation that both adds a layer of complexity to the EU-Russia relationship and underscores the rising influence of crypto networks in global affairs. “The sanctions are designed to put pressure on third-country actors who might be weighing their ties with A7 against their relationships with the EU and UK,” a senior EU official, requesting anonymity, told us. This move is not just about penalizing A7; it’s a strategic gambit to sway those on the fence about engaging with the network.
